FAQs about First Aid Educating for Child Care Professionals

Q: What is the duration of a normal emergency treatment course for childcare experts? A: The duration of an emergency treatment course can vary depending upon the level of qualification sought and the training supplier. Nonetheless, a lot of basic emergency treatment courses for child care experts vary from 4 to 8 hours.

Q: Are there any certain emergency treatment programs customized for childcare specialists? A: Yes, there are specific emergency treatment programs created particularly for child care specialists. These programs cover topics such as pediatric CPR, choking emergency situations in infants and kids, and usual childhood injuries.

Q: How commonly should childcare experts restore their first aid certification? A: Emergency treatment certifications normally have an expiration day varying from 1 to 3 years. It is recommended that childcare professionals restore their qualification prior to it ends to guarantee they have up-to-date expertise and skills.

Q: Is it required for all personnel in a child care center to go through first aid training? A: Yes, it is highly advised for all team member in a child care facility to go through emergency treatment training. Emergencies can happen when a qualified team member is not present, and having numerous trained individuals enhances the chances of a timely and effective response.

Q: Can emergency treatment training for childcare professionals be personalized to attend to specific threats in the child care setting? A: Yes, some training suppliers provide personalized emergency treatment training courses that resolve details dangers generally run into in a child care setup. These training courses may cover subjects such as allergies, asthma emergencies, or monitoring of usual youth illnesses.

Q: Exist any kind of online emergency treatment training courses readily available for childcare professionals? A: Yes, there are online first aid courses readily available for child care specialists. Nonetheless, it is necessary to ensure that the on-line training course is certified and offers practical hands-on training chances to supplement the theoretical content.
